Create Splunk dashboard with data from excel file

1. Can Saved Searches Update an Excel File with Predefined Columns?

Not directly. Splunk saved searches export results in formats like:

CSV

JSON

XML


But you can:

Schedule a saved search to export as a CSV.

Use a script (Python, PowerShell, etc.) outside of Splunk to:

Watch the exported file.

Insert data into a predefined Excel template.

Save it as .xlsx.



Example:

Use the outputcsv command in your saved search:

your search query
| outputcsv my_output.csv

Then use Python (with pandas and openpyxl) to map this CSV into a predefined Excel template.


---

2. Can You Use Excel Files to Create Splunk Dashboards?

No, not directly. Splunk dashboards rely on:

Indexed data in Splunk

Real-time or scheduled searches

Lookups (CSV-based), not .xlsx


But you can:

Convert your Excel file to CSV

Upload it as a lookup table in Splunk

Use it in searches like:


| inputlookup my_excel_data.csv

From there, you can create dashboards.
